I'm thinking about getting for the first time....it is 41.00. Is that with the tip added?

The price might vary by sailing.

 

You can check on the price yourself by using your Cruise Planner. Put the beverage package in your shopping cart and check-out. You will be able to see the total price before your credit card info is requested.

I dont understand how they do their math. I am sailing next August and just got the email about it being discounted. It says $48 per day. But 20% off of $55/day is $44, not $48. We have a large group going, you'd think they'd offer something if we get a certain amount of people to book, like a slightly better rate. But the least they could do is get the math right since they are advertising a 20% off rate. I'm also trying to decide if i should wait it out or book now since we have almost a year.

 

Some ships/sailings have a price of 61.00 a day so 20% makes it around 48.00 as you are seeing. Each ship and each sailing are priced independently so you cant compare one price to another.
